The jackalope, according to legend, was the creation of Douglas Herrick and his brother — two brothers who were hunters with taxidermy skills. In the 1930s, they grafted deer antlers onto a jackrabbit and sold the Frankenstein-esque monstrosity to a hotel in Douglas, Wyoming.
